Harold Dean Carr Jr. Obituary

It is with great sadness that we announce the death of Harold Dean Carr Jr. (Kimberling City, Missouri), who passed away on January 24, 2020, leaving to mourn family and friends. He was predeceased by: his mother Barbara Carr (Hemphill); his brother James Michael Carr; and his grandparents, Clyde, Ernestine Carr, Lloyd and Fannie Hemphill.

He is survived by: his wife Sherry White; his children, Heather Wells of Branson, Missouri and Nicholas Carr (Brooke) of Kimberling City, Missouri; his father Harold "Peanut" Carr Sr. (Dorothy) of Crane, Missouri; his siblings, Anita Pugh (Matt) of Branson West, Missouri, Karla Jenkins (Gerald) of Reeds Spring, Missouri and Max Carr (Jodie) of Curryville, Missouri; his grandchildren, Austin, Matthew, Maddy, Izzy, Kaden, Shelby, Hunter and Mavis; and his stepchildren, Mason Coleman and Shelby White. He is also survived by several nieces and nephews.
